Where is the VW Atlas made?
Assembled in Chattanooga, Tennessee, the seven-passenger Atlas offers competitive levels of technology and spaciousness combined with hallmark Volkswagen driving dynamics and attention to detail, all at a price designed to draw attention in the crowded family SUV segment. Optionally, the VR6 may be combined with four-wheel drive. Standard equipment includes: eight-speed automatic transmission, LED headlights and App-Connect as a smart phone interface. The Atlas is manufactured at the US plant in Chattanooga.For markets outside China, the Atlas/Teramont is produced in the Chattanooga plant in Chattanooga, Tennessee, United States. The vehicle features a transverse mounted four-cylinder or Volkswagen’s VR6 engine.

Why not buy a VW Atlas?
The Volkswagen Atlas suffers from several common problems, including fractured rear coil springs, fuel tank leaks, electrical issues, shattering sunroofs, premature airbag deployments, and a glitchy forward collision-avoidance system. VW Atlas: NHTSA Safety Rating As tested by the National Highway Traffic Administration (NHTSA), the 2021 VW Atlas earned a 5-Star Overall Safety Rating. When tested for safety in the event of a Frontal Crash, the VW Atlas earned a 4-Star Safety Rating.Volkswagen’s Atlas is a formidable competitor among three-row SUVs, putting size, functionality, and competitive pricing front and center. Are there any recalls on the 2021 Volkswagen Atlas?
Volkswagen is recalling over 271,000 more Atlas SUVs from the 2021 through 2024 model years and Atlas Cross Sport SUVs from the 2020 through 2024 model years to fix a faulty sensor that may prevent the front passenger airbag from deploying in a crash. This could increase the risk of injury to the front passenger. These have the worst reports from drivers behind the wheel and are the least practical investment for those who want to make wise decisions.The 2021 Volkswagen Atlas has a predicted reliability score of 70 out of 100. A J. D. Power predicted reliability score of 91-100 is considered the Best, 81-90 is Great, 70-80 is Average and 0-69 is Fair and considered below average.

The passenger room is great, it has responsive steering and a ton of cargo space available.Volkswagen Atlas Unfortunately, the following model was another lousy year for Volkswagen’s three-row SUV. While it has fewer complaints than the 2018 model year, the 2019 Atlas has its fair share of significant reliability woes. CarComplaints had racked up over 360 complaints and nine recalls for the 2019 Atlas.VW Atlas Deemed Great by J. D.
